The phrase "when elephants battle the ants perish" is used to show the consequences of battles between powerful people on the less powerful. Like the ants in the metaphor, the less powerful people often get caught under foot and killed or hurt in arguments they aren't a part of at all.

What will happen if the ants were removed from the acacia tree?

If the ants were removed from the acacia tree the trees would be stripped of their leaves by elephants. The ants serve as a defense mechanism for the trees.
